■(JI) 'Matiusha'
2012, Kaulen
'Matiusha' Матюша (
Mariya Kaulen, R. 2012) Sdlg. J12/10-10. JI (3 F.), 35.5" (90 cm), Early midseason bloom. Standards bright rose-wine, narrow white rim; style arms wine-violet, narrow white rim; Falls thick pink venation on white ground, heavier at edges, yellow signal.
'Rose Frappe' X
'Uslada'.
Translation: Матюша = form of the name Matthew.
